# NOTE for the weekly eng sync:
# This module is step one of retiring the old Cravenmoor ORM layer.
# Yes, it's ugly — the legacy mapper leaks connections when a
# transaction spans more than two entity groups, so we're wrapping
# it with pool limits and aggressive statement timeouts until the
# new Fernhollow data layer lands. Don't "just raise the pool size"
# when things get slow; that's how we melted staging in March.
# If you touch these, flag it at the sync so nobody gets surprised.
# The current tuning constants follow below.

limits module of tafop-hahop:
WEIGHTS = {
    "julmir": 223,
    "belox": 987,
    "lamion": 470,
    "pelath": 609,
    "fraok": 1010,
    "eliion": 343,
    "drudor": 342,
}

### Gateway restart procedure — Furrowlink telemetry

Before approving changes to the restart script, verify it drains the MQTT buffer first; the Furrowlink gateway loses in-flight tractor telemetry otherwise. Confirm the health probe waits for broker reconnection, not merely process start. The gateway authenticates to the upstream ingestion service using a credential that the deployment env file sets on the line immediately below.

secret setting of hawep-yahig: LEDGER_TOKEN29=41b5d6315371c92885eaeb077fb63

**Ticket: Config drift on BounceSift processor**

The email bounce processor in the Larkfield environment has drifted from the values committed in the release branch. Retry windows and suppression thresholds no longer match, which likely explains the duplicate suppression entries reported Tuesday. Please reconcile before the Thursday cut. For reference, the currently deployed configuration on the live node reads as follows.

config for yajep-yahof:
[briax]
port = 9200
region = outer-2
host = briax.nelvrocorp.test
team = raleth
timeout_ms = 1500
retries = 1